Budget-friendly travel

Budget-friendly travel refers to the act of traveling to destinations that are both affordable and within one’s financial means. This can involve traveling to low-cost destinations or finding ways to make travel to expensive countries more economically feasible.

Budget-friendly travel is becoming increasingly popular as more people seek to explore the world without breaking the bank. This type of travel typically involves careful planning and research to find good deals on flights, accommodations, and activities. Those who practice budget-friendly travel may also opt for low-cost transportation options, such as taking trains or buses instead of renting a car.

Additionally, budget-friendly travel may involve making concessions on the type of accommodations or activities chosen. For example, travelers may opt to stay in hostels or budget hotels rather than luxury resorts, or may choose to participate in free or low-cost activities rather than pricey tours and attractions.

Ultimately, budget-friendly travel is about making the most of one’s resources and experiencing new cultures and destinations without overspending. By being resourceful and flexible, travelers can enjoy all the benefits of travel without breaking the bank.
